Abstract

A gain-controlled sinusoidal oscillator circuit based on current-controlled current conveyors (CCCII) is introduced. The circuit contains three CCCIIs and two grounded capacitors and no resistor. The amplitude of the output current can be controlled electronically. Hence, the proposed topology is suitable for IC implementation. The CCCII has been implemented using 0.35 µm CMOS technology and the PSPICE simulation results are given.
